Job titles most likely to require experiments
| Role | Postings mentioning | % requiring |
|---|---|---|
| Product Manager | 6 | 28.6% |
| Software Engineer | 4 | 19.0% |
| Engineering Manager | 2 | 9.5% |
| UX Researcher | 2 | 9.5% |
| Data Analyst | 1 | 4.8% |
| Data Scientist | 1 | 4.8% |
| Director of Data Science | 1 | 4.8% |
| Embedded Product Manager | 1 | 4.8% |
| Principal Product Manager | 1 | 4.8% |
| Product Designer | 1 | 4.8% |
